Desmanthus illinoensis (Michaux) MacMillan ex B.L. Robinson & Fernald. Common Bundleflower, Prairie Mimosa. Phen: Jun-Jul; Aug-Nov. Hab: Prairies, open woodlands, barrens, marsh edges, disturbed areas. Dist: OH, MN, and ND south to Panhandle FL, TX, and NM; with scattered adventive occurrences east and west of the native distribution.
Origin/Endemic status: Native
